So I recently built a new system(with exception of the gpu, awaiting some price decreases)and I had consistent issues with fps in most/all games I play dropping to say, 30-60fps for about 3-5 seconds this would normally happen every 10-15 minutes.
after absolutely going crazy for two days changing everything i could think of(driver updates, bios updates mixing old working components with new ones etc etc) the only thing that worked is changing the config TDP to 65w(88w,75a,150a) This then completely resolved my issues, and it's been running splendidly since.
I was wondering if anyone would be able to explain why this would be the case? as i would like to know what the specific issue(s) might be.
system specs as follows:
Ryzen 7 7700x
b650 tomahawk
MSI rtx 2060s (them prices still not dropping)
kingston fury 5600mhz c36 2x16gb
crucial p3 4.0 2tb
corsair H100 elite cappellix 240mm AIO
lian li sp850 sfx psu
